Modular Kitchen Islands

A kitchen island is often the centerpiece of a culinary space. Modular kitchen islands are particularly popular as they can be resized, rearranged, and accessorized. Here are some key points to consider:

  • Sizes and Shapes: Look for islands with adjustable dimensions or those that can be combined with other units to fit your kitchen layout.
  • Functionality: Choose an island with additional features like built-in storage, electrical outlets for appliances, or a breakfast bar for dining.
  • Design Options: Many manufacturers offer customizable finishes, colors, and materials, from butcher block tops to stainless steel surfaces.

Features to Customize

When choosing a modular kitchen island, consider the following customizable features:

  • Storage Solutions: Add pull-out drawers, open shelving, or cabinets to maximize organization.
  • Materials: Opt for wood, laminate, or metal that complements existing decor.
  • Mobility: Select an island with wheels for flexibility, allowing you to reposition it as needed.

Adjustable Shelving Units

Shelving is crucial in any kitchen, providing accessible storage while enhancing visual appeal. Adjustable shelving units can be customized to meet your specific storage needs. Here’s how:

  • Height and Width: Choose a shelving unit that can be adjusted for height to accommodate various kitchen items, from spices to large pots.
  • Material Selection: Wood, metal, and glass shelves are all options that can be tailored to match your kitchen aesthetic.
  • Style Integrations: Create a cohesive look with customizable finishes and colors that blend with your cabinetry or décor.

Types of Adjustable Shelving

There are several types of adjustable shelving that work well in kitchens:

  • Wall-Mounted Shelves: Perfect for maximizing vertical space, wall-mounted shelves can be customized in size and color.
  • Freestanding Units: These can be moved around as needed and are available with multiple configurations.
  • Corner Shelves: Make use of typically wasted space in your kitchen with corner shelving options that fit snugly against walls.

Pantry Cabinets

Having an organized pantry is essential for a functional kitchen. Customizable pantry cabinets can help you keep dry goods, canned foods, and many other kitchen essentials neatly arranged. Consider these features:

  • Configuration: Look for units that can be designed with adjustable shelving, pull-out baskets, and built-in dividers.
  • Doors: Choose between open or closed cabinets depending on your preference for accessibility versus aesthetics.
  • Finish Options: Match your pantry cabinet finish with other kitchen furniture for a cohesive look.

Custom Pantry Solutions

Choose from custom pantry solutions that fit your cooking habits:

  • Pull-Out Pantry: Great for tight spaces, a pull-out pantry cabinet allows easy access to items without taking up extra floor space.
  • Sliding Door Units: Optimize space with sliding door cabinets that can be tucked away when not in use.
  • Open Shelving Units: If you prefer your items on display, this can offer both function and style.

Customizable Dining Tables

Depending on the layout and size of your kitchen, a dining table can serve as an excellent multifunctional piece of furniture. Customizable dining tables can be matched to your kitchen decor while maximizing seating capacity:

  • Shape and Size: From round to rectangular, find a shape that fits your kitchen space and number of diners.
  • Extension Options: Choose tables with leaf extensions for additional seating during gatherings.
  • Material Choices: Customizable options may include wood finishes, metals, and unique styles to reflect your taste.

Design Considerations for Dining Tables

When selecting a customizable dining table, keep these considerations in mind:

  • Finish Matching: Ensure the finish of the dining table complements your kitchen cabinets and other furniture pieces.
  • Leg Styles: Choose from pedestal bases for a more open feel or traditional legs for stability.
  • Color Coordination: Select colors that blend seamlessly or provide a striking contrast to add interest.

Creating Your Custom Kitchen Space

Customizing your kitchen furniture isn’t just about aesthetics; it’s also about creating functionality tailored to your cooking and entertaining needs. Here are some steps to help guide you:

1. Assess Your Needs

Before making any decisions, consider how you use your kitchen:

  • Do you frequently host dinner parties? Consider larger tables and additional seating.
  • Is storage a challenge? Identify spaces where cabinets and shelving would be most beneficial.
  • Do you require additional workspace? Investing in a well-designed island can provide extra preparation area.

2. Measure Your Space

Accurate measurements are key. Measure your kitchen area to determine what size and shape of furniture will fit. Consider:

  • Clearance space around each piece of furniture for comfortable movement.
  • Proximity of your island or table to other cooking elements like the stove and refrigerator.

3. Choose a Cohesive Style

When selecting furniture, choose pieces that complement each other. Consider a consistent color palette and materials to achieve a unified look.

4. Test Out Designs

Many manufacturers allow you to see 3D layouts of how your selected furniture will look in your space. This step is crucial to visualizing the final result. Take advantage of this service to ensure compatibility with your kitchen layout.

5. Prioritize Quality

Investing in high-quality materials for your kitchen furniture ensures longevity, durability, and aesthetic appeal. Look for custom pieces made from solid wood, quality metal, and sturdy construction methods.

Utilizing Custom Storage Solutions

Custom storage solutions can change how efficiently your kitchen operates. Think beyond traditional cabinets and drawers:

  • Pull-Out Shelving: Perfect for deep cabinets where items are often hard to reach, pull-out shelves make accessing your goods straightforward.
  • Hanging Racks: Ideal for small kitchens, hanging pots, and utensils free up cabinet space and create an interesting visual element.
  • Built-In Appliances: Consider appliances integrated into cabinetry for a seamless look while optimizing space.

Maximizing Storage with Custom Solutions

Here are a few ideas for maximizing storage using customized solutions:

  • Baskets and Bins: Utilize stylish baskets within cabinets for easy access and organization of smaller items.
  • Vertical Storage: Invest in vertical pull-out storage for spices and canned goods, maximizing cabinet height.
  • Multi-Functional Furniture: Opt for furniture like storage benches or tables that can double as storage units.
